Seriously suggest a referral from your family physician/GP for Cognitive Behavioral Therapy via specialist/psychologist. 

I've personally had CBT for a few years with a psychologist and find it amazing. In my case, it was recommended for my serious injuries and to help me cope since I was determined to work through it without conventional prescription meds. I think this worried all my therapists and they pushed me into the counselling.  In all honesty, I can tell you that it really helps change your perception in a very gurmat attitude because it trains you to think and act outside of your own ego. Also from my experience, I can tell you that you can't target the problem areas that need addressing by use of cbt videos or books but you definitely need the physical guidance and counselling of a professional. They are trained to provide this service and now how to address each area with their expertise.

They will also give you techniques that will be tailored just for you to help you focus and become efficient with your paath and simran. I have been quite lucky since my psychologist has deep spiritual interests of her own and she has been able to help guide with improvisation of additional ideas and methods.
